You are not logged in.

W[!]ck

Trainee

  • "W[!]ck" started this thread

Posts: 50

Location: Berlin

Occupation: Schüler

  • Send private message

1

Thursday, September 13th 2007, 6:12pm

Befehl Fenster

Hi;

Ich will über Eventscript 1.5 ein Fenster erstellen was bei einem bestimmten Wort (In dem fall "befehle") in den Chat ein Fenster öffnet (dessen Inhalt ich dan ausfüllen kann) . Mit welchem Code und mit welcher .cfg kann ich das bewerkstelligen ? (Genau so ein Fenster was sich auch bei der player_activate.cfg öffnet )

Vielen dank im vorraus

mfg W[!]ck :mrgreen:

2

Thursday, September 13th 2007, 6:15pm

Re: Befehl Fenster

was genau meinst du mit fenster? o.O

hEiNz

Professional

Posts: 705

Location: Deutschland

Occupation: Freischaffender Künstler

wcf.user.option.userOption53: Nein

  • Send private message

3

Thursday, September 13th 2007, 6:45pm

Re: Befehl Fenster

http://www.mani-admin-plugin.com/index.php?option=com_smf&Itemid=26&topic=8434.0">http://www.mani-admin-plugin.com/index. ... pic=8434.0</a>


schaumal da ist das selbe kannst halt den chatbefehl ändern und " befehl " oder so kommt aber das gleiche raus. ist ein normales popupfenster

Isias

Intermediate

Posts: 460

Occupation: Student

  • Send private message

4

Thursday, September 13th 2007, 7:23pm

Re: Befehl Fenster

Den Code finde ich nützlich, ich poste ihn hier auch mal damit er nicht verloren geht:

Source code

1
if (event_var(text) equalto "WortDeinerWahl") then exec events/configname.cfg

configname.cfg

Source code

1
es_menu 10 event_var(userid) "Hier den Text eingeben\n Einen Zeilenumbruch ehältst du duch\n"


Habs zwar nicht getestet, aber müsste nicht auch

Source code

1
if (event_var(text) equalto "WortDeinerWahl") then es_menu 10 event_var(userid) "Hier den Text ein geben\n Einen Zeilenumbruch ehältst du duch\n"
funktionieren? Um den Umweg über die config zu umgehen?

speddy

Trainee

Posts: 64

Location: Ansbach

  • Send private message

5

Thursday, September 13th 2007, 7:42pm

Re: Befehl Fenster

Es geht aber auch anders das das wort was du eingibst net im chat zu sehen ist werde es morgen mal schnell machen habe heute keine zeit mehr

W[!]ck

Trainee

  • "W[!]ck" started this thread

Posts: 50

Location: Berlin

Occupation: Schüler

  • Send private message

6

Friday, September 14th 2007, 8:23am

Re: Befehl Fenster

Vielen Dank euch allen :)
Hat geklappt

Hab aber noch eine Frage zur player_aktivate.cfg wollte deswegen jetz nicht extra ein neues Topic aufmachen.

Frage : Mit welchem Befehl wirde der Name des Players angezeigt also Wilkommen Spielernamen \n \n bla bla bla

mfg W[!]ck

speddy

Trainee

Posts: 64

Location: Ansbach

  • Send private message

7

Friday, September 14th 2007, 2:58pm

Re: Befehl Fenster

der hier event_var(es_username)

8

Friday, September 14th 2007, 8:09pm

Re: Befehl Fenster

willkommensmeldung kannst du so machen:

Source code

1
2
3
4
5
6
event player_activate
{
    es_xset string 0
    es_format string "Willkommen %1 auf dem \n \n bla bla bla" event_var(es_username)
    es_delayed 5 es_menu 5 event_var(userid) server_var(string) 
}


das mit dem saybefehl kannste auch mal so testen:

Saybefehl:

Source code

1
2
3
4
5
6
7
8
9
10
11
12
block load
{
  es_xset string 0
  es_format string "Hier den Text ein geben\n Einen Zeilenumbruch ehältst du duch\n"
  
  es_xregsaycmd WortDeinerWahl scriptname/saybefehl
}

block saybefehl
{
  es_delayed 2 es_menu 5 event_var(userid) server_var(string) 
}

W[!]ck

Trainee

  • "W[!]ck" started this thread

Posts: 50

Location: Berlin

Occupation: Schüler

  • Send private message

9

Friday, September 14th 2007, 8:23pm

Re: Befehl Fenster

Danke :mrgreen:

event_var(es_username) klappt aber leider nicht hab ES 1.5 (neuste Version)

Meine player_aktivate.cfg :

Quoted

es_menu 20 event_var(userid) "Servus event_var(es_username) \n \n Server Regeln : \n \n - Keine Beleidigungen \n - Nicht Campen \n - Keine Clanwerbung \n \n Wichtig : \n \n - Wir suchen Stammspieler \n - Wir suchen Member \n - www. h2o-deluxe .de \n \n Kein Ranking!!! \n Viel spass"


Der Name erscheint einfach nicht heul

mfg W[!]ck

10

Friday, September 14th 2007, 8:31pm

Re: Befehl Fenster

mache es so. erstelle dir einen ordner willkommen im verzeichnis:cstrike\addons\eventscripts

im ordner willkommen eine datei namens es_willkommen.txt

inhalt der datei:

Source code

1
2
3
4
5
6
event player_activate
{
    es_xset string 0
    es_format string "Servus %1 \n \n Server Regeln : \n \n - Keine Beleidigungen \n - Nicht Campen \n - Keine Clanwerbung \n \n Wichtig : \n \n - Wir suchen Stammspieler \n - Wir suchen Member \n - www. h2o-deluxe .de \n \n Kein Ranking!!! \n Viel spass" event_var(es_username)
    es_delayed 5 es_menu 20 event_var(userid) server_var(string) 
}


schreibe in die autoexec.cfg
es_load willkommen


server restart oder peer hlsw in der console es_load willkommen

Chrisber

Administrator

Posts: 1,030

Location: localhost

wcf.user.option.userOption53: Ja

  • Send private message

11

Friday, September 14th 2007, 11:17pm

Re: Befehl Fenster

Es heißt auch player_activate.cfg und nicht player_aktivate.cfg

So long, Chris
Und das letzte, was gesagt wird, wenn die Welt untergeht, ist: das ist technisch unmöglich.